Political Pathologies from The Sopranos to Succession by Robert Samuels
This book argues that highly praised prestige TV shows reveal the underlying fantasies and contradictions of upper-middle class political centrists. It contributes to a greater understanding of the ways media and political ideology can circulate on a global level through the psychopathology of class consciousness.Robert Samuels, PhD, holds doctorates in Psychoanalysis and English and teaches at the University of California, Santa Barbara, USA.
